Cara Mengonversi CMX ke TXT Menggunakan GroupDocs.Conversion untuk .NET

Perkenalan

Kesulitan mengonversi Corel Metafile Exchange Image File (.cmx) ke format Plain Text (.txt) yang serbaguna? Panduan lengkap ini menyederhanakan proses menggunakan GroupDocs.Conversion for .NET. Anda akan mempelajari cara menyiapkan lingkungan dan mengintegrasikan fitur konversi ini dengan lancar.

Apa yang Akan Anda Pelajari:

  • Menyiapkan dan menggunakan GroupDocs.Conversion untuk .NET
  • Petunjuk langkah demi langkah untuk mengonversi file CMX ke format TXT
  • Aplikasi praktis konversi file dalam proyek .NET

Mari kita bahas prasyarat yang Anda perlukan sebelum menerapkan solusi ini.

Prasyarat

Sebelum memulai, pastikan lingkungan pengembangan Anda sudah siap. Berikut ini yang Anda perlukan:

Pustaka dan Versi yang Diperlukan

  • GroupDocs.Konversi untuk .NET: Versi 25.3.0 (atau lebih baru)

Persyaratan Pengaturan Lingkungan

  • Versi Visual Studio yang kompatibel terinstal di komputer Anda.
  • Pemahaman dasar tentang C# dan kerangka kerja .NET.

Menyiapkan GroupDocs.Conversion untuk .NET

Untuk mulai menggunakan GroupDocs.Conversion, instal pustaka tersebut di proyek Anda. Berikut caranya:

Konsol Manajer Paket NuGet:

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I:

dotnet add package GroupDocs.Conversion --version 25.3.0

Langkah-langkah Memperoleh Lisensi

  • Uji Coba Gratis: Uji kemampuan perpustakaan dengan mengunduh versi uji coba.
  • Lisensi Sementara:Dapatkan ini untuk mengevaluasi fitur lengkap tanpa batasan.
  • Pembelian: Pertimbangkan untuk membeli jika Anda membutuhkan akses jangka panjang untuk proyek Anda.

Mari kita atur konfigurasi dasar menggunakan C#:

using GroupDocs.Conversion;
using System.IO;

string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Y", "ConvertedFiles");
if (!Directory.Exists(outputFolder))
{
    Directory.CreateDirectory(outputFolder);
}

// Inisialisasi konverter dengan jalur file CMX Anda
using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Y\\sample.cmx"))
{
    // Kode pengaturan konversi ada di sini
}

Panduan Implementasi

Konversi CMX ke Format TXT

Bagian ini menguraikan cara mengonversi Berkas Gambar Corel Metafile Exchange (.cmx) menjadi berkas Teks Biasa (.txt).

Langkah 1: Muat File Sumber

Mulailah dengan memuat file CMX sumber Anda menggunakan Converter Kelas ini menangani proses konversi.

using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Y\\sample.cmx"))
{
    // Langkah tambahan akan menyusul di sini
}

Langkah 2: Tetapkan Opsi Konversi

Konfigurasikan opsi konversi untuk menentukan bahwa Anda menginginkan output dalam format TXT. Gunakan WordProcessingConvertOptions dan atur formatnya ke TXT.

WordProcessingConvertOptions options = new WordProcessingConvertOptions { Format = GroupDocs.Conversion.FileTypes.WordProcessingFileType.Txt };

Langkah 3: Lakukan Konversi

Lakukan konversi dengan memanggil Convert metode dengan opsi yang Anda tentukan. Ini akan menyimpan berkas yang dikonversi di folder keluaran yang Anda tentukan.

string outputFile = Path.Combine(outputFolder, "cmx-converted-to.txt");
converter.Convert(outputFile, options);

Tips Pemecahan Masalah

  • Pastikan Direktori AdaSelalu verifikasi bahwa direktori keluaran dibuat sebelum menyimpan file.
  • Periksa Jalur FilePeriksa ulang jalur berkas masukan dan keluaran Anda untuk menghindari kesalahan runtime.

Aplikasi Praktis

GroupDocs.Conversion untuk .NET tidak hanya mengonversi CMX ke TXT. Berikut ini beberapa kasus penggunaan di dunia nyata:

  1. Pengarsipan Dokumen: Ubah format dokumen lama menjadi teks agar pengarsipan lebih mudah.
  2. Ekstraksi Data: Ekstrak data yang dapat dibaca dari file berbasis gambar untuk analisis.
  3. Integrasi dengan CMS: Secara otomatis mengonversi dokumen yang diunggah pengguna dalam sistem manajemen konten.

Pertimbangan Kinerja

Untuk mengoptimalkan kinerja saat menggunakan GroupDocs.Conversion, pertimbangkan kiat berikut:

  • Pemrosesan Batch: Jika mengonversi beberapa file, pemrosesan batch dapat mengurangi overhead.
  • Manajemen Memori: Buang benda-benda dengan benar untuk membebaskan sumber daya.
  • Operasi Asinkron: Terapkan metode asinkron untuk konversi non-pemblokiran.

Kesimpulan

Dalam tutorial ini, Anda telah mempelajari cara menyiapkan dan menggunakan GroupDocs.Conversion for .NET untuk mengonversi file CMX ke format TXT. Pustaka canggih ini dapat diintegrasikan ke dalam berbagai aplikasi, sehingga meningkatkan kemampuan pemrosesan dokumen.

Langkah selanjutnya termasuk menjelajahi lebih banyak opsi konversi yang tersedia di pustaka GroupDocs.Conversion atau mengintegrasikannya ke dalam proyek yang lebih besar.

Mengapa tidak mencoba menerapkan solusi ini hari ini?

Bagian FAQ

  1. Apa itu GroupDocs.Conversion?

    • Ini adalah pustaka serbaguna untuk mengonversi lebih dari 50 format file dalam aplikasi .NET.
  2. Bagaimana cara menangani file CMX berukuran besar selama konversi?

    • Pertimbangkan untuk mengoptimalkan penggunaan memori dan menggunakan metode asinkron untuk mengelola file yang lebih besar secara efisien.
  3. Bisakah saya mengonversi tipe dokumen lain dengan GroupDocs.Conversion?

    • Ya, ia mendukung berbagai format selain CMX dan TXT.
  4. Apakah ada dukungan untuk .NET Core?

    • Ya, GroupDocs.Conversion bekerja lancar dengan aplikasi .NET Framework dan .NET Core.
  5. Bagaimana cara memecahkan masalah kesalahan konversi?

    • Pastikan semua jalur sudah benar dan file masukan Anda tidak rusak. Periksa log untuk mengetahui pesan kesalahan terperinci.

Sumber daya

Jangan ragu untuk menjelajahi sumber daya ini sembari Anda mempelajari lebih dalam kemampuan GroupDocs.Conversion untuk .NET. Selamat membuat kode!